Adjective [English]

IPA: /ˈsʌlki/ Audio: LL-Q1860 (eng)-Vealhurl-sulky.wav [UK] Forms: sulky [positive], sulkier [comparative], sulkiest [superlative]
Etymology: sulk + -y Etymology templates: {{ety-suffix|sulk|y}} sulk + -y Head templates: {{adj|sulky|sulkier|sulkiest}} [POS TABLE]
  1. A sulky person is silent or bad-tempered after being upset. Synonyms: sullen, morose

Noun [English]

IPA: /ˈsʌlki/ Audio: LL-Q1860 (eng)-Vealhurl-sulky.wav [UK] Forms: sulky, sulkies [plural]
Etymology: sulk + -y Etymology templates: {{ety-suffix|sulk|y}} sulk + -y Head templates: {{noun|2=sulkies}} [POS TABLE]
  1. A sulky is a two-wheeled cart that is often used in horse racing.
